Looks like you're using Box Sync to locally access your folders. 

If that's the case, we firmly suggest for this change in your environment as Box Drive is the current Box desktop experience, does not require manual syncing (though this is available through the mark for offline option), and the issue you're experiencing is likely to be resolved straight away after installation. By installing Box Drive from this link Box Sync will be automatically uninstalled, and any files that had not synced up to Box will be preserved in your old Box Sync folder.
